no its not the DBA's job, a dba is a DATABASE administrator. An Oracle dba won't know about every single product oracle makes, why should they automatically know about the the app server? The only similarity in the installer is that it looks the same, the options are all different.

The responsibility lies with the administrator of the application server, whoever that may be. People shouldnt assume a DBA shuold know just becuase it has the word Oracle in it
